Latest Patents
Jensen's latest patents include "Systems and methods for efficiently implementing an N-step manufacturing process for producing a mechanical part." This patent describes a method that involves creating a parametric master model to represent a part in an N-step manufacturing process. The method allows for the creation of process plans and updates based on the parameters after each manufacturing step.
Another significant patent is "Systems and methods for representing complex n-curves for direct control of tool motion." This invention involves controlling a mechanism using higher-dimensional n-curves. It establishes electronic communication between a computer and an electronically-controlled mechanism, utilizing process control software to enhance the precision of tool motion.
